Kentucky football in the NFL: Bbn’s Sunday impact players

The NFL preseason is in full swing, and Big Blue Nation has plenty of reasons to tune in on Sundays. Over the past decade, Kentucky football has gone from a modest NFL pipeline to producing impact players across the league. This year is no different — the Wildcats are well represented at nearly every position.

**Quarterback Will Levis** is in his second year with the Tennessee Titans, looking to build on a rookie season where he flashed big-play ability and toughness in the pocket. His connection with new offensive weapons will be a storyline to watch.

**Wan’Dale Robinson** has become a reliable target for the New York Giants, bringing explosive speed and quickness in open space. Meanwhile, **Randall Cobb** — still defying time — is back for another season, now in a veteran mentorship role.

On defense, [**Josh Allen**](https://wildcatbluenation.com/jaguars-star-josh-hines-allen-s-tearful-reveal-about-son-s-cancer-battle-will-break-you) remains a star pass rusher for the Jacksonville Jaguars, coming off a career year in sacks. **Bud Dupree** will be wearing Falcons colors, hoping to add veteran stability to Atlanta’s defense. **Mike Edwards**, now with the Buffalo Bills, continues to showcase his ball-hawking skills in the secondary.

Other BBN standouts include **Quinton Bohanna** on the defensive line for the Detroit Lions, **Logan Stenberg** in the trenches for the Steelers, and **Luke Fortner** as a center for Jacksonville. **Chris Rodriguez Jr.** looks to make his mark in Washington’s backfield as a power runner.

For Kentucky fans, Sundays aren’t just about NFL drama — they’re a chance to watch former Wildcats carry the BBN banner on football’s biggest stage.
